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/heroku/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
关闭后页面中的JSF托管bean清除字段_Jsf_Managed Bean - Fatal编程技术网

关闭后页面中的JSF托管bean清除字段

关闭后页面中的JSF托管bean清除字段,jsf,managed-bean,Jsf,Managed Bean,问题是,我有一个包含表单和一些字段的页面。填写完字段并保存记录后,我关闭页面。当我再次访问页面时,字段中的值仍然保留。我希望在我关闭页面后,这些字段应该被清除,但事实并非如此。我想知道为什么会这样。我已经尝试过使用不同的作用域,但没有成功。在将托管bean保存到数据库后重新初始化它。 或 在获取表单相关网格时RequestScoped应执行此操作。代码。代码。密码在哪里?

问题是,我有一个包含表单和一些字段的页面。填写完字段并保存记录后,我关闭页面。当我再次访问页面时,字段中的值仍然保留。我希望在我关闭页面后,这些字段应该被清除,但事实并非如此。我想知道为什么会这样。我已经尝试过使用不同的作用域,但没有成功。

在将托管bean保存到数据库后重新初始化它。


在获取表单相关网格时

RequestScoped
应执行此操作。代码。代码。密码在哪里?